Metal Casting
We started with 30 pennyweights of bronze casting grain poured into the crucible. The start time was 2:12 and the finish time was 2:20.
| Temperature (F) | Steps |
| 878.7 | Initial heat of flame |
| 1217 | First metal temp |
| 1276 | Second metal temp |
| 1624 | Third metal temp (flask goes in) |
| 1700 | Pin dropped, spinning |
| 998 | Flask is removed |
| 889 | Still red (do not quench) |
| 505 | Quenched, hot after smoothing |
| Weight (raw, pre-cut metal) | 48g |
| Weight (with sprues cut off) | 24g |
